As an essential factor for the human development, reading is a lesson that should be priority at
the beginning and during school and academic life of every student. Despite being a recurring
preoccupation for the elementary, middle and high school education systems, many students
are arriving at the university without more advanced reading skills and competences, which
affects negatively in their learning in higher education systems. In view of this scenario, projects
of literary reading that cultivate the reading habit among academics are necessary, so that they
can grow their knowledge and personal development, and thus becoming more critics and
intellectuals who think for themselves. In this context, the library is one of the important spaces
of reading intervention that it needs to be, constantly, active with literary reading projects. Thus,
this work was made aiming to verify the relevance and possibility of a project of readers’
formation in the library of the Institute for the Studies of the Humid Tropics (IETU) of the
Federal University of the South and Southeast of Pará (UNIFESSPA-PA). The research is
qualitative, quantitative, bibliographic, documentary and interpretative. Methodologically,
semi-structured questionnaires were used. Also, to understand the user profile of the library,
some institutional documents like the book lending registry were analyzed in order to
demonstrate the relationship between the students, literary books and the library. Regarding the
theoretical foundation, the following author was used as research methodology: Thiollent
(1985), and the contributions of Cosson (2006) as well on the structuring of reading groups.
Lajolo (2002); Paulino (2005); Yunes (1995, 2003 e 2012); Jouve (2002, 2013); Cosson (2006,
2019); Compagnon (2003); Candido (2004) and Azevedo (2004) can also be highlighted when
it comes to understanding the reader/literary formation. To discuss matters about university
libraries and readers’ circles, Soares (2009), Silva (1987, 1997); Roca (2012); Pereira Júnior
(2019); Bortolin (2006); Bortolin and Almeida Jr. (2011); Bortolin and Santos (2014); Silva et
al (2015); Silva (1987, 1997), Cosson (2014); Fontes (2012); Almeida Jr (1997) and Milanese
(2008), among others, were relied upon, as they describe in their theories the function of the
library in its literary readers’ formation role through projects involving reading groups. Results
include the contribution that the activities of literary reading implemented by the library of the
unity IETU/UNIFESSPA-PA had on the reading formation of the group and in the effectiveness
of the librarian as a reading interventionist. The results also show the importance of activities
of readers’ formation, as well as the contribution of the library in taking these activities to the
academic community and the community in general, which, consequently, evince literature as
fundamental in the life of students. |
